Q. What percent slope is 30 degrees?

Table of Common Slopes in Architecture

DegreesGradientPercent
30°1 : 1.7357.7%
45°1 : 1100%
56.31°1: 0.67150%
60°1 : 0.6173.2%

Q. How do you find the rise and run of an angle?

Since degree of slope is equal to the tangent of the fraction rise/run, it can be calculated as the arctangent of rise/run. Figure 7.10. 2 A rise of 100 feet over a run of 100 feet yields a 45° slope angle. A rise of 50 feet over a run of 100 feet yields a 26.6° slope angle.

Q. Why do we use rise over run?

A steeper line goes up more in the same distance: If we used the “run” over the “rise”, then the less steep line would have a greater slope, which wouldn’t make sense: So the ratio as we define it fits the word “slope”, by being greater when the line slopes more.

Q. What is the difference between rise and raise?

To raise means to lift or move something or someone upward. It also means to increase. To rise means to move upward or to increase.

Q. What is rise to run ratio?

The ratio of rise over run describes the slope of all straight lines. This ratio is constant between any two points along a straight line, which means that the slope of a straight line is constant, too, no matter where it is measured along the line.

Q. What lines have a slope of 0?

A horizontal line has slope zero since it does not rise vertically (i.e. y1 − y2 = 0), while a vertical line has undefined slope since it does not run horizontally (i.e. x1 − x2 = 0). because division by zero is an undefined operation.
